Abstract
The trend of software development has changed from local to global software development (GSD) with acceleration in information and communication technologies. GSD offers certain benefits like reduced cost, high quality, availing skilled human resource and latest technology etc. It also faces a lot of challenges like communication coordination issues, cultural, language and temporal challenges along with the technical challenge of software integration. The objective of the current study is to identify success factors for software integration to assist GSD vendors in integrating the software components into a final working product. We have used the systematic literature review (SLR) process by following standard SLR guidelines. We have identified a list of 14 success factors by extracting data from 89 selected papers. Out of these, 9 factors were ranked as critical success factors (CSFs). Some of the top ranked CSFs are “Consistency in Requirements and Architecture Design”, “Intra and inter team Communication and Coordination” and “Component/Unit Testing prior to integration”. We have also analyzed these CSFs on the basis of period published, project size and methodology used. We identified 9 CSFs which may assist GSD vendors in almost all size of projects at different phases of the software integration process